Paper Flowers

As much as I love flowers, I can't justify spending lots of money on them for one night. So instead, we are having book page flowers! We  have been collecting candle stick holders as we find them at local thrift stores, all costing less than $2 each. The paper flowers are pinned into foam balls which cost less than 50 cents a piece. And so far, I have only had to use one book I already had. We plan on making at least 30, three for each table, however I have a feeling we will end up making a few more. On average, flowers for a wedding cost $2,000. By the time all of mine are completed, we will have spent less than $100!

Unplugged

We have made the decision to have an unplugged ceremony. While I love the idea of guests wanting to capture our special day, I don't love the idea of the professional photos we are paying for being ruined by cellphones being lifted up into the air to get an Instagram worthy shot. Of course we are allowing cellphone and camera usage at the reception! We will even be encouraging it with signs at each table!

Our Engagement Photos

Okay, so this might not work for everyone, because not everyone is a photographer or has a family full of photographers. While we will be hiring a professional to shoot our actual wedding day, it was awesome not having to spend a dime on our engagement photos. I am a control freak when it comes to our photos (because after all, I am a photographer) so I did all of the editing on our engagement photos after my sister shot them. Whether you choose to spend lots on engagement photos or your budget is pretty tight, I highly recommend showing your photographer ideas you like. This can be as simple as creating a Pinterest board. When I shoot weddings, I always have the brides create a board of shots they like and show me what shots are important to them and what styles they like.
